Finance Review Summary — Warranty-Cost Overrun

Warranty costs on the Bramwell HX series exceeded plan by 34% this quarter, driven by a faulty seal batch from a single supplier lot. Reserve has been topped up accordingly; supplier recovery claim is in progress. Field-failure rates have stabilised since the August fix. No restatement required. The confidential note below outlines how this affects near-term plans.

board note of kagep-yahig: Only 9 of the 120 pilot accounts renewed Quenix, so a churn review is set for April 1.

CI NOTE: Webhook delivery retries firing twice

The Quillbarn dispatcher retries failed webhook posts with exponential backoff, but since Friday's merge, the retry queue and the dead-letter sweeper both re-send the same payload. Downstream consumers see duplicates within the 30s window. Disable the sweeper via the ops flag until the idempotency key fix lands. The trace token for the affected run follows.

build token for tawip-yageg: htk9_92ac43d42

Subject: DR drill Friday — ParityPeek

Hey! Quick heads-up: Friday morning we're running the disaster-recovery drill for ParityPeek, our hotel rate-parity checker. We'll fail over the scraper fleet and comparison DB to the Ashgrove region. Should be painless, but hold the release train until we confirm. To unlock the standby admin panel, use the recovery passphrase below.

unlock words, yawig-kagef: gordor-holvan-ulaael-pramir-ulaiel-tamdor

Before archiving a cold storage bucket in Glacierette, detach all plugin hooks. Run the freeze job, confirm checksum parity, then revoke scoped tokens. Do not delete manifests; the Vexhall recovery service reads them during account restoration. If the bucket owner's account is locked, trigger the recovery flow from the Opsgate console, not the plugin API. Archival completes within 20 minutes. Plugins must tolerate 404s on frozen objects. To unseal the restore job, use the passphrase below.

vault phrase of fawig-yagug = tamix-norys-ulaix-joreth-druius-jorael-briax-prair-lamael-caseth-brivan-lamius-istius